Job Summary

The Government Partnership Manager is responsible for driving the business forward, managing a book of a business team delivering on both city account management for our largest cities as well as winning new business in markets. This position works with the government org as a team to focus on action plans and goals that cut through the noise inherent in the government process, focusing the team on what needs to be done.

In this role, you will be responsible for city retention in North American markets (focused on Canadian and US markets) as well as the maintenance of current accounts in both areas, responsible for ~22MM of Bird's projected revenue in North America. We will expect this team to retain slots next year allowing Bird to deploy 1,250 net slots throughout North America.

Responsibilities

  • Responsible for scooter slot retention in North America responsible for ~22MM projected revenue.
  • Retain and win slots next year, allowing Bird to deploy 1,250 net slots in the US and Canada.
  • Work at a high level with our key city and university partners
  • Create high impact strategy designed to improve ridership, strengthen relationships with key partners, and maximize net revenue
  • Work with our Pursuits team on RFP proposals and submissions to both address the unique needs of each of our partners and improve our city commitments
  • Guide regulatory change to improve overall quality of service delivery and rider experience
  • Speak at public gatherings or government meetings to champion Bird and alternative transportation
  • Grow our business into new markets through outreach and sales into city governments
  • Engage in onsite demonstrations and presentations of our technology and services

Must Haves:

  • 5+ years progressive experience in Government Relations, Policy, Sales, Account Management, or relevant industry experience
  • Proven ability to build and/or strengthen relationships with city officials of key cities
  • Proven ability to train others to build and/or strengthen relationships with city officials of key cities
  • Strategic ability to build processes that do not rely on third parties to build relationships with key city stakeholders, allowing Bird to internalize relationship-building and management
  • Collaborate cross-functionally to ensure that Bird fulfills all obligations required by the cities and ensure that the company remains responsive to local concerns as they emerge
